After missing out on defending the Premiership title, Ngezi Platinum Stars have set their sights on the Chibuku Super Cup as they eye a quick return to the African Safari.
For the platinum miners, competing in the African Safari is part of the club’s long-term plan to compete at the high-est level on the continent.
Club president Takawira Maswiswi told Zimpapers Sport that winning the Chibuku Super Cup will be a consolation for the club after missing out on the league title.
